The Third Annual Event of the Polar Bear Club drew the usual crowd of two
spectators and one now veteran participant, J. R. Jarosh. At attempt at choreography was
made by staging an auxiliary plunge off nearby Cave Point, which wasnt
any warmer than expected. AP, UP, CNN, NBC, ABC and CBS were notable by their
absence.
This year the launching of a similar event was attempted in
Baileys Harbor by Heidi Reiche. Heidi convinced Green Bay TV station channel
5 to send a
camera. Unfortunately, it was operated by a person who lost an
argument with the ice shelf, rendering the person wet, the camera inoperable
and the pictures unobtainable.
Perhaps this is why that TV station had cold feet about reporting about
Polar Bears for the next few years.
The next year J. R. and Heidi wisely joined forces.
